Alusine KamaraAlusine Kamara, Alexandria VA
On the job, Alusine Kamara, a native of Sierra Leone, can now fix almost any problem he encounters! Attending CET in Alexandria VA, he learned as much about heating ventilation and air conditioning as he could, and now providing a valuable service to his employer, he receives $15.75 per hour, and an annual bonus and a 401K plan. His employer, the Army-Navy Country Club also provides lunch, uniforms, as well as health and dental insurance for him and his 3 children...what a success story!

Luis MurilloLuis Murillo, Sacramento
Luis Murillo, a Mexican immigrant has demonstrated success for his passion in automotive repair. After years of manual labor, he attended CET Automotive Maintenance training, and now works with sophisticated electronics and hydraulics, and earns compensation that allows him to have pride in himself, and provides independence and prosperity.

Juan Padilla, San Jose, California
Juan Padilla's life has improved in so many ways since he left the fields, attended CET training and became an electrician. "Now that I make $25 per hour and only work one job, I have time to go out, visit places, and save a little bit of money. My wife attends Monterey University and my brothers, encouraged by my success, have also left the fields for better employment."

Vanessa Nevarez, Salinas, California
In January 2001, Vanessa Nevarez, 18 years old, single mother of two, decided that it was time to do something with her life. At the Sobrato CET in September 2001, Vanessa completed her Medical Assisting program and was hired at Clinica Salud in Salinas. It was Vanessa's own determination, will, and the hope for a better future for her family that enabled her to be where she is right now: a certified Medical Assistant, a high school graduate, and a dedicated mother of three.
